By AKOMA CHINWEOKE
Worried by CBN criticism that greeted the proposed introduction of N5,000 note by the Central Bank Nigeria, CBN, the Nigerian Security Printing and Minting Plc , NSPM, is set to create more awareness on how the proposed currency restructuring would help shore up value in the economy.
The Managing Director of NSPM, Mr. Ehi Okoyomon, said the forthcoming 17th edition of the Association of African Banknotes and Security Documents Printers AABSDP Conference will be used to create more awareness on the proposed currency restructuring by the CBN.
The conference, to be declared open tomorrow in Lagos by the CBN Governor, Lamido Sanusi, according to the AABSDP, would showcase the largest exhibition in high level security print in Africa where stakeholders and industry players meet to interact and discuss issues in the industry.
“Following the Federal Government’s endorsement of N5,000 which has created a lot of controversy , the conference is an opportunity for exchange of knowledge and awareness creation.
